The point at which symptoms visual experience of people often depends on the level of their visual capabilities and the number of hours spent watching the computer screen. Several of visual symptoms experienced by computer users are provisional and will decrease after stopping work computer. Some individuals, however, may have reduced visual capabilities continues, such as blurred vision distance, even after qu’arrĂȘtant work a computer. If nothing is done to address the problem, symptoms continue to recur and perhaps worse with the future use of computer. The problems not corrected vision, as farsightedness and astigmatism, eye or centre capacity unsatisfactory coordination of eye, and changes of aging eyes, such as presbyopia, can increase the severity of the symptoms of CVS. The problems not corrected vision can contribute to the development of visual symptoms with a computer.
